Features and Benefits
- Double Volute, Axially Split Casing Design minimizes hydraulic radial forces in any condition down to the minimum flow
- Suction and Discharge Nozzles are integrally cast in the lower casing half to permit pump disassembly without disturbing the piping
- Near Centerline Mounting provides superior pump alignment and performance at elevated temperatures
- Double Suction Impeller provides hydraulic axial balance and allows minimal NPSHr. ISO 21049/API 682 Seal Chambers ensure ample flow around the seal faces and accommodate numerous seal designs
- Heavy-Duty Shaft Design ensures trouble-free operation below the first critical speed
- Standard Renewable Casing and Impeller Wear Rings provide hydraulic stability and high operating efficiency
Specifications
- ISO 13709 / API 610
- Hydraulic Institute
- Flows to 12000 m3/h (52835 gpm)
- Heads to 565 m (1854 ft)
- Pressures to 150 bar (2175 psi)
- Temperatures to 200°C (400°F)
- Speeds to 6000 rpm
Size Range: Sizes from 150 mm (6 in) to 750 mm (30 in)
